Film criticism is the analysis and evaluation of films, individually and collectively. In general this can be divided into journalistic criticism that appears regularly in newspapers and other popular, mass-media outlets and academic criticism by film scholars that is informed by film theory and published in journals.

Election, Romania: a dead man elected as the mayor of a city

English

Neculai Ivaşcu

The ex-mayor of the Romanian city Voineşti, Neculai Ivaşcu, tried to get a new mandate during the second tour of the local election. Unfortunately, he died right in the morning of the day of the election, yesterday, due to an older disease.

The law didn't specify what to be done in this situation, so he remained on the list of the candidates for the mayor of that city.
